Id remove the lamp and check the seal/seals where the bulb holders secure to the light itself if a bulb has been replaced recently failing that check the lense is not coming away from the rest of the light as there only bonded on so any stress or impact on the light can cause it to break away a little and let water leak in

If you have any of those silicone sachets you get in a shoe box, stick one inside the light. They soak up moisture.
